Real Operational Experience in Maui Homes
Bathroom remodels in Maui aren’t one-size-fits-all. Housing styles range from older plantation-era homes in Wailuku with aging galvanized supply lines to modern slab-on-grade construction in Kihei and Wailea.
Our team routinely addresses:
- Corroded angle stops in ocean-facing condos in Wailea caused by salt air exposure.
- Re-piping galvanized systems in older Wailuku homes to correct low pressure and sediment buildup.
- Installing pressure-regulating valves in Kihei properties where municipal pressure fluctuations affect fixture longevity.
- Hard water mineral scaling in Upcountry areas like Makawao and Kula.
- Slab plumbing access challenges common in Maui construction.

Signs You May Need Bathroom Remodeling in Maui
Older 3.5+ GPF toilets increasing monthly water bills.
Persistent low water pressure due to corroded or undersized supply lines.
Visible rust staining from deteriorating galvanized pipes.
Frequent fixture leaks despite repeated repairs.
Cracked or outdated venting systems affecting drainage performance.
Mold or moisture behind tiled shower walls caused by slow leaks.

Why Professional Bathroom Remodeling Matters
Plumbing mistakes during a remodel can lead to long-term problems, including:
- Incorrect venting may allow sewer gas exposure.
- Improper drain slope (¼ inch per foot standard) leads to chronic clogs.
- Code violations can result in failed inspections.
- Unpermitted work may impact homeowner insurance coverage.
Maui County requires permits for:
- Re-piping
- Fixture relocation
- Structural plumbing modifications
WaterSense-labeled fixtures can reduce bathroom water use by 20% or more. In Hawaii, conservation matters due to limited island resources, and upgrading to efficient fixtures during a remodel helps reduce long-term strain on municipal systems while lowering monthly utility costs.According to the Environmental Protection Agency, WaterSense-labeled fixtures can reduce bathroom water use by 20% or more.
